> Just to make sure I'm understanding this correctly - does the v4 
> firmware drop compatibility for older cards, or is it just that Broadcom 
> dropped support in the driver at the same time as the firmware changed, 
> and the new firmware will still also drive the old cards?

We can't extract bcm43xx_microcode2.fw from v4 drivers. You need this 
file for old rev2+3 0x812 cores. So we don't know what firmware we 
should load into those old cores. I think broadcom never developed a new 
v4 style firmware for their old hardware.
